C.M.P.No.17582 of 2023 in C.M.S.A.No.53 of 2003 P.VELMURUGAN, J., The above appeal is pending from the year 2003 for service of notice. This is the pathetic situation of this Chartered High Court. If we are not able to find out the reasons to allow the appeal, the cases cannot be prolonged indefinitely because of the attitude of the Registry and the counsel.

2. Though respondents 2 to 5, 7, 8, 10 and 11 have been served and their names are being printed in the cause list, they have not entered appearance either through counsel or in person.

3. The learned counsel for the appellant is permitted to take substituted service on the un-served respondents i.e. sixth and ninth respondents' last known address by effecting paper publication in one issue of 'Dhina Malar', indicating the date of hearing as 24.08.2023. Proof of such paper publication shall be filed before this Court.

4. This petition is ordered, accordingly.

List the matter on 24.08.2023.
